Meta-majors are groupings of similar areas of study designed to help you narrow down your interests and decide on a major. Exploring meta-majors will help you pick the right classes and complete your educational goals on time. Meta-Major: Business and Management Do you want to start your own business? Search site Close search box × Student Rights & Responsibilities Home About Us Our Values Student Rights and Responsibilities Essential Elements of a High-Quality Education Folsom Lake College envisions an education system in which specific rights, obligations, and expectations for students and education providers will be clearly expressed, so that all participants in the educational process, including families, can understand and respond to them. These rights, obligations, and expectations would define what the college considers to be the essential elements of high-quality teaching and learning to which all students and education providers should have access. Folsom Lake College proposes that these rights, obligations, and expectations be defined as follows: Every student has the right to: Be taught by a competent, fully qualified faculty member. Receive an education, including intervention when necessary, that is sufficient to allow successful transition into the next levels of education and into the workforce. Be provided access to high-quality learning materials and resources, including textbooks and technologies that foster and support the knowledge and skills they are expected to learn. Receive counseling and academic advising to assist in successful educational progress and planning. Be in a clean, modern, and safe environment that is conducive to learning. Be provided with sufficient information regarding educational, economic, social, and political options to be able to make informed choices for their future. Receive information about financial support for postsecondary education attendance. Every student would be expected to: Attend college regularly and participate in the educational opportunities that are provided. Commit to the level of effort needed to succeed. Contribute to maintaining a safe, positive college environment. The Los Rios Student Rights and Responsibilities are based upon the following three fundamental concepts: College students, citizens of the United States, and foreign guests are members of the academic community. They have the same rights and freedoms that all citizens have as students, and must comply with federal and state laws and statutes. Students must also comply with Los Rios Board policies and individual college rules and regulations. Search site Close search box × About Us Home About Us Falcon Pride Since 2004, Folsom Lake College has provided exceptional educational opportunities to the diverse communities of eastern Sacramento and western El Dorado counties. The college serves over 11,000 students at the Main Folsom campus, the El Dorado Center in Placerville, the Rancho Cordova Center, and online. Folsom Lake College is committed to enriching and empowering students by bridging knowledge, experience, and innovation. FLC offers educational opportunities and support for students to transfer to four-year institutions, to improve foundational skills, to achieve career goals, and to earn associate degrees or certificates. Title IX of the Education Amendments of 1972 prohibits discrimination based on sex in education programs and activities that receive Federal financial assistance. Title IX applies, with a few specific exceptions, to all aspects of federally funded education programs or activities, including all of the operations of educational institutions that receive Federal financial assistance, as well as any education or training programs operated by any other recipient of Federal financial assistance. Source: U.S. Department of Education, Sex Discrimination: Overview of the Law What is sexual harassment? Sex-based harassment can take multiple forms. Harassers can be students, college staff, or even someone visiting the college or district, such as a student or employee from another college or district. Sexual harassment (including sexual violence) is a form of sex-based harassment. Sexual harassment means conduct on the basis of sex that satisfies one or more of the following: Quid pro quo harassment – “this for that” sexual harassment: A school employee conditioning the provision of a school-related aid, benefit, or service on an individual’s participation in unwelcome sexual conduct Hostile environment harassment: Unwelcome conduct on the basis of sex that is so severe, pervasive, and objectively offensive that it effectively denies a person equal access to the school’s education program or activity. Such conduct can be carried out by school staff, a student, or another person Specific offenses: Sexual assault , dating violence , domestic violence , or stalking as defined in the Violence Against Women Act Harassment can be carried out by school staff, a student, or another person. It can occur in-person or online, including through email, texts or messages, apps, or other technologies. Depending upon facts and circumstances, some examples may include, but are not limited to: Unwelcome conduct on social media platforms , such as sexually demeaning or discriminatory slurs or threats of sexual violence Nonconsensual texting, posting, or otherwise sharing naked or intimate images of a person — whether real, altered, or created through artificial intelligence (AI) technologies Stalking using technology , including sending multiple unwanted text messages, creating fake social media accounts, or using apps to work around a blocked number Title IX requires a school to address sexual harassment that occurs in its education program or activity in the United States. Career Education (formerly known as Career Technical Education, or CTE) is a term for educational programs that specialize in the skilled trades, applied arts and sciences, and modern technologies. CE programs are designed to improve job skills and marketability. Search site Close search box × Order Official Transcripts Home Admissions Get Started and Apply Admissions and Records Office Order Official Transcripts Order Transcripts Online Folsom Lake College has contracted with Parchment to provide transcript ordering and electronic delivery of PDF transcripts. Parchment can send PDF transcripts through an encrypted and secure service to any valid email address (another college or university, third-party recipient, or the requestor). Current students, former students, and alumni can request a PDF transcript online anytime and from virtually anywhere. Submit separate orders for each Los Rios college attended.
